Abstract Comfort

stars pour like lustrous rain as they separate excreting lights tender in my eyes if only it was that beautiful... interruptions divide us in prismatic gloom brittle hearts prick like needles to our veins our kiss spreads a swell of heartache passionate love is our survival the moments change and we splinter into two peaceless feelings breathe on the back of my neck sadness compels a new voice of stone tears cleanse the thoughts we smudge in hopes to paralyze the days apart scented airwaves salt our disintegrated stitches my days cannot heal without you I tattoo your smile on my mind to raise the sky from the ground’s ambitions flaking metaphors spill like dust tacky love songs breed visions on obscure wings elevated beyond the reach of time I’ll get you back in a rainbow’s frequency and sew the color to your eyes kissing the flavor trickling from our hearts
